Parameterized Simpson-like inequalities for differentiable Bounded and Lipschitzian functions with application example from management science
By: N. Boutelhig, B. Meftah, W. Saleh and A. Lakhdari
Abstract
In this paper, based on a given parameterized identity that generates a quadrature rule family similar to Simpson’s second formula, we establish some new Simpson-like type inequalities for functions with bounded as well as Lipchitzian derivatives from which we can deduce the famous 3/8-Simpson’s inequality. The study concludes with an application example from management science.
